Online Scheduling with Hard Deadlines

نویسندگان

  • Sally A. Goldman
  • Jyoti Parwatikar
  • Subhash Suri
چکیده

We study non-preemptive, online admission control in the hard deadline model: each job must be either serviced prior to its deadline, or be rejected. Our setting consists of a single resource that services an online sequence of jobs; each job has a length indicating the length of time for which it needs the resource, and a delay indicating the maximum time it can wait for the service to be started. The goal is to maximize total resource utilization. The jobs are non-preemptive and exclusive, meaning once a job begins, it runs to completion, and at most one job can use the resource at any time. We obtain a series of results, under varying assumptions of job lengths and delays, which are summarized in the following table.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Online Parallel Machine Scheduling With Hard Deadlines

This paper considers the problem of online job scheduling on M identical machines with hard deadlines. The processing time and delay time of a job are known only on its arrival. Jobs are discarded if they do not meet delay time requirement. The objective of the present work is to minimize the number of tardy jobs. A lower bound of competitive ratio when the processing time and delay time are bo...

متن کامل

Online Packet Scheduling with Hard Deadlines in Wired Networks

The problem of online job or packet scheduling with hard deadlines has been studied extensively in the single hop setting, whereas it is notoriously difficult in the multihop setting. This difficulty stems from the fact that packet scheduling decisions at each hop influences and are influenced by decisions on other hops and only a few provably efficient online scheduling algorithms exist in the...

متن کامل

On the Competitiveness of On-Line Scheduling of Unit-Length Packets with Hard Deadlines in Slotted Time

It is shown that the competitive factor for online scheduling of unit-length packets with hard deadlines in slotted time is in the interval [0.5, φ], where φ is the inverse of the golden ratio, φ = ( √ 5 − 1)/2 ≈ 0.618034. Moreover, any static priority policy, that in each slot schedules a maximum value packet irrespective of deadlines, achieves competitive factor 0.5.

متن کامل

Lex-Optimal Online Multiclass Scheduling with Hard Deadlines

On-line scheduling of unit-length packets with hard deadlines by a single server in slotted time is considered. First, the throughput optimal scheduling policies are characterized. Then multiclass packets are considered in which each packet has an M -bit class identifier, and a new optimality property called lex-optimality (short for lexicographic optimality) is defined for on-line scheduling p...

متن کامل

On-Line Scheduling on Uniform Multiprocessors

Each processor in a uniform multiprocessor machine is characterized by a speed or computing capacity, with the interpretation that a job executing on a processor with speed for time units completes units of execution. The on-line scheduling of hard-real-time systems, in which all jobs must complete by specified deadlines, on uniform multiprocessor machines is considered. It is known that online...

متن کامل

Guaranteed On-Line Weakly-Hard Real-Time Systems

A weakly hard real-time system is a system that can tolerate some degree of missed deadlines provided that this number is bounded and guaranteed off-line. In this paper we present an on-line scheduling framework called BiModal Scheduler (BMS) for weakly-hard real-time systems. It is characterised by two modes of operation. In normal mode tasks can be scheduled with a generic scheduler (possibly...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• J. Algorithms

دوره 34  شماره 

صفحات  -

تاریخ انتشار 2000